觅得一款低价的双目VR摄像头,如图,该摄像头的输出图像格式是yuyv格式
淘宝店 猛男电子 也有卖 40来块钱一个吧,真的很低成本了呜啊呜啊
官方的上位机如图,只能在windows下使用,USB口插入摄像头可以读取到单目图像、VR图像和双目图像,下面有4个切换模式的按键
该摄像头支持UVC协议,在linux下默认只能读取单目的图像,因此需要模拟上位机的切换模式按键给双目摄像头发送数据。
树莓派中可以通过uvcdynctrl命令给发送数据来切换摄像头的模式。
树莓派中需要安装uvcdynctrl,执行如下命令
sudo apt-get install uvcdynctrl
安装完成后并把uvcdynctrl命令写成shell脚本来实现四个模式的切换。切换成双目模式的脚本内容如下,video0为摄像头,可根据实际改动。最后一行中用0x0100,0x0200,0x0300,0x0400指令分别可以切换到左单目,右单目,红蓝模式,双目模式。
uvcdynctrl -d /dev/video0 -S 6:8 '(LE)0x50ff'
uvc